Brief summary

This is a small study exploring the effect of the mode of delivery of salbutamol (inhaler vs. nebuliser) on the small airways of the lungs in patients with asthma. The effects of the two modes of delivery will be compared using measures of small airways disease from impulse oscillometry and multiple breath nitrogen washout. Asthma patients will attend two visits. At each visit, they will have these measures taken before and after bronchodilator therapy with salbutamol. At one visit, they will have nebulised salbutamol and at the other (in random) order, they will have salbutamol via metered-dose inhaler with spacer.

Interventions

One dose of inhaled salbutamol (1mg) given via metered-dose inhaler (with spacer) over 10 minutes and by nebuliser over 10 minutes on separate days and in random order. Treatment administered and observed by research staff during attendance at research unit. Washout between treatments a minimum of 24 hours.

Inclusion criteria

Physician-diagnosed asthma requiring a minimum of treatment with regular inhaled corticosteroid

Exclusion criteria

• Diagnosis of COPD, bronchiectasis, lung cancer. • Other co-morbidity likely to affect study participation. • Current smoker • Poor asthma control (see 2016 NZ asthma guidelines for definition) • Previous ICU admission for acute asthma
